Newsmaker: Michael Clark ![](https://webarchive.library.unt.edu/web/20130216215133im_/http://www.pittsburgh.va.gov/images/icon_external_link.gif) Pittsburgh Tribune-Review | January 15, 2013
Michael Clark, 36, a reservist from Ross, oversaw installation and setup at the Fisher House, a new $5.5 million lodge free for families of veterans receiving care at the VA Pittsburgh Healthcare System's University Drive Campus.
Heroes at Heinz Field various | September 11, 2012
VA Healthcare - VISN 4 and the Pittsburgh Steelers joined together for the fifth annual Heroes at Heinz Field event for Veterans who recently served in Iraq and Afghanistan. The Veterans in attendance practiced their football skills alongside eleven current Steelers who also signed autographs and posed for pictures. The Veterans ended the evening with dinner in a stadium lounge that overlooks Heinz Field. View the media coverage below:

VA Pittsburgh to dedicate $75.8 million facility Wednesday ![](https://webarchive.library.unt.edu/web/20130216215133im_/http://www.pittsburgh.va.gov/images/icon_external_link.gif) Pittsburgh Business Times | May 1, 2012
The VA Pittsburgh Healthcare System on Wednesday will dedicate a new, $75.8 million facility at its University Drive campus. The VA’s Consolidation Building will house outpatient services and 78 private psychiatric beds.

Ambulatory Care Center Achieves LEED Silver Certification ![](https://webarchive.library.unt.edu/web/20130216215133im_/http://www.pittsburgh.va.gov/images/icon_external_link.gif) Medical Construction & Design | January 17, 2012
VA Pittsburgh Healthcare System (VAPHS) Ambulatory Care Center was recently awarded LEED-NC Silver certification, using the LEED-NC Rating System version 2.2. The project achieved 33 credit points in addition to meeting all LEED prerequisites.
The new Ambulatory Care Center at the H. J. Heinz Division integrates primary care, specialty follow-up, physical rehabilitation, audiology, dental, prosthetics, rehab medicine, community services, outpatient pharmacy and patient education.

Veterans Research Lab Focuses on Creating Special Devices for Disabled Veterans ![](https://webarchive.library.unt.edu/web/20130216215133im_/http://www.pittsburgh.va.gov/images/icon_external_link.gif) Forbes.com | September 28, 2011
People with disabilities have some new, powerful devices to make daily living easier. The Human Engineering Research Laboratories (HERL) is a part of the VA Pittsburgh Healthcare System and has created robotic arms, better wheelchairs, and other mobility devices.
